Understanding the Role of a Psychologist PTSd: How They Help You Heal
The journey toward healing PTSD begins with understanding what a specialized psychologist PTSd offers. Here’s an in-depth look at their pivotal role:
Assessment and Diagnosis
The first step in effective PTSD treatment involves comprehensive assessment. Psychologists utilize validated tools, interviews, and observation to understand the severity of symptoms, identify co-occurring conditions like depression or anxiety, and develop an accurate diagnosis. This diagnostic process ensures that all aspects of your mental health are addressed.
Trauma-Focused Therapy Modalities
Once diagnosed, a psychologist PTSd employs multiple therapeutic techniques that have demonstrated efficacy in trauma treatment. These include:
-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): Focuses on identifying and challenging distorted thought patterns linked to trauma, helping clients reframe negative beliefs and reduce avoidance behaviors.
-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R): Uses guided eye movements to process traumatic memories, reducing their emotional charge and restoring mental balance.
- Prolonged Exposure Therapy: Assists clients in gradually confronting traumatic memories and reducing their power through controlled exposure, fostering habituation.
- Mindfulness-Based Techniques: Helps develop present-moment awareness, improving emotional regulation and decreasing hyperarousal.
Providing Coping Mechanisms and Resilience Building
Beyond processing trauma, a psychologist PTSd teaches practical skills to manage stress, prevent relapse, and enhance overall mental resilience. These include relaxation strategies, grounding techniques, and lifestyle adjustments supporting recovery.
Supporting Comorbid Conditions and Holistic Wellbeing
Often, PTSD coexists with other mental health challenges such as depression, substance abuse, or anxiety disorders. A competent therapist considers these factors and coordinates holistic approaches, including referrals to nutritionists or support groups when necessary, ensuring comprehensive care.

FAQs About Psychologist PTSd and PTSD Treatment
Q: How long does PTSD therapy usually last?
A: The duration varies based on severity, personal circumstances, and therapy modality, but typically ranges from several months to over a year for comprehensive treatment.
Q: Can PTSD be cured?
A: While some may see complete symptom resolution, many individuals experience significant relief and effective management. The goal of therapy is to restore control, reduce distress, and promote long-term resilience.
Q: Is online therapy effective for PTSD?
A: Yes, many evidence-based therapies like CBT and EMDR are adaptable to virtual formats, offering flexibility and access for clients nationwide.
